Instrumental Musical Delight from the UK…

Marking the end of the fortnight long Guru Purnima celebrations, a group of musicians from the UK offered an Instrumental Medley this evening here in Prasanthi Nilayam.

The programme organised under the auspices of Sri Sathya Sai Organisations – UK had Roopa Panesar playing on Sitar along with Kirpal Singh Panesar on Taar Shehanai accompanied by Talvin Singh on Tabla and Prasanna Tevah Rajah on Mridangam. Playing for a full one-hour, the quartret produced some scintillating music, first playing in tandem and later engaged in Jugalbandhi enthralling the august assembly weaving musical magic.

The evening numbers were a mix of popular devotional numbers coupled with Prasanthi Mandir Bhajans.

All the four artistes are professionals accomplisehd in their own area, trained by reputed masters and later performed at various prestigious music shows and festivals. Roopa Panesar  had already performed in the Divine presence, thrice earlier, in 2003 along with Late Jagjith Singh followed by in 2009 with a solo performance and last year, in 2012. Roopa consideres these golden opportunities as the zenith of her personal and professional life.

At the end of the presentation all the artistes were felicitated. Even as bhajans continued prasadam was distributed to the entire assemblage of devotees. Bhajans ended with ‘Thusrsday Special’ in Bhagawan’s mellifluous voice, “Om Shivaya…Om Shivaya…“  Mangala Arathi was offered at 1835 hrs. marking the end of the session.
